比特币作为一种新兴的数字货币,其价格波动吸引了无数投资者的关注。在投资比特币时,许多人常常会问一个将比...
比特币(Bitcoin)作为最早也是最广为人知的加密货币,拥有着庞大的用户基础和不断扩大的生态系统。然而,对于很多新用户而言,真正理解如何使用比特币及其相关的工具,尤其是钱包,是一个不小的挑战。本文将深入探讨比特币测试网钱包的创建、使用方式以及最佳实践,为大众用户提供实用的指导。
在正式进入主题之前,我们首先需要理解测试网(Testnet)的概念。测试网是一个与主网(Mainnet)相互独立的网络,允许开发者和用户在没有真实经济损失的情况下进行实验和测试。比特币的测试网使用与主网相同的代码,但其币值没有实际意义,且主要用于开发和测试目的。
创建比特币测试网钱包相对简单。首先,你需要确保选择一个支持测试网的比特币钱包。许多流行的钱包,如Electrum、Bitcoin Core或Some-Wallet等,都具备这一功能。以下是创建测试网钱包的步骤:
1. **选择钱包软件**:根据个人需求选择支持测试网的钱包。例如,Electrum是一个轻量级的钱包,快速且易于操作,而Bitcoin Core提供完整节点功能,适合需要更高安全性及隐私性的用户。
2. **下载安装钱包**:访问官方网站,下载钱包软件,并按照其指示进行安装。
3. **创建新钱包**:打开软件后,选择创建新钱包。在选择网络类型时,确保选择“测试网”选项。
4. **设置备份与安全**:创建完成后,需保留好恢复种子短语,以防钱包数据丢失。同时,如果钱包支持密码,加设密码将进一步增强安全性。
一旦你的比特币测试网钱包创建成功,接下来便是如何正确使用它。以下是一些基本的使用指南:
1. **获取测试网比特币**:由于测试网中的比特币没有实际价值,用户需要通过测试网水龙头(faucet)获取。用户只需输入测试网钱包地址,即可收到少量的比特币。网络上有许多免费的水龙头可以使用。
2. **发送与接收比特币**:在钱包中,用户可以选择发送或接收测试网比特币。发送时需要输入接收地址和金额;接收则只需将钱包地址分享给转账者即可。
3. **查看交易记录**:钱包软件通常会提供交易历史记录,用户可以随时查看已完成的交易。
4. **测试智能合约或应用**:使用开发者工具可以构建和测试基于比特币的应用程序或智能合约。测试网为开发者提供了一个安全环境,以减少直接在主网运行时可能遇到的问题。
使用比特币测试网钱包时,有几点最佳实践和注意事项可以帮助用户更安全地进行操作:
1. **安全备份**:虽然测试网没有经济损失的风险,但丢失钱包数据会导致无法访问数据,因此务必备份种子。
2. **使用防火墙和杀毒软件**:即使是在测试网环境下,网络安全依然重要。确保你的设备安装防火墙和杀毒软件,防止恶意软件入侵。
3. **避免发送真实比特币至测试网地址**:测试网的地址和主网地址格式相似,但并不相同,确保区分,避免在测试网中操作真实比特币。
4. **保持钱包软件更新**:钱包软件定期更新,以确保提供最新的安全性和功能,务必保持软件为最新版本。
在讨论比特币测试网钱包时,许多用户可能会有以下疑问:
测试网与主网之间的区别可以从多个维度进行分析,以下是几个关键的方面:
1. **经济价值**:最显著的区别在于,测试网中的比特币没有实际经济价值,任何人在测试网中获取的比特币都是免费且用于测试之用。而主网中的比特币一旦产生就有实际的经济价值,可以用来进行交易或投资。
2. **网络环境**:测试网主要关注开发和测试,鼓励开发者构建和改进应用,因此其网络较为开放,交易确认时间较短,而主网则关注安全和稳定性。
3. **使用目的**:测试网专为开发者设立,允许他们进行代码测试、应用测试等。而主网则是用户实际使用比特币进行交易和投资的地方。
4. **交易币种**:在测试网上的比特币实际上是无价值的,不可在主网上流通。因此,用户在主网的交易活动不会与测试网的活动相互影响。
寻找可靠的测试网水龙头对于获取测试网比特币至关重要,如今互联网上有很多可用的水龙头,但安全性和可靠性各有不同。以下是一些建议:
1. **社区推荐**:可以通过比特币相关的论坛、社群或开发者社区,询问或查找推荐的水龙头,社区中的用户往往有经验,会避免不可靠的选项。
2. **水龙头信誉**:访问水龙头前,可以通过搜索引擎阅读其他用户对其的评论和评价。如果有众多负面反馈,则应避免使用。
3. **验证支付方式**:一些水龙头会要求用户完成某些任务,如完成验证码、点击广告等。如果需要输入私人信息或下载文件,需谨慎对待。
4. **访问官方网站**:许多开发者会在其官方网站上列出推荐的水龙头,确保访问正品。
对于新手来说,使用比特币测试网具有多种好处:
1. **零风险实验**:在测试网中进行交易和操作不会造成经济损失,用户可以放心尝试各种功能。这对于理解比特币及其运作方式非常有帮助。
2. **学习开发技能**:测试网为开发者提供了一个安全便捷的环境,用户可通过搭建自己的节点、编写智能合约等方式,提高自己的技术水平。
3. **熟悉钱包操作**:新用户在测试网中能够熟悉如何创建、备份及恢复钱包,进而提高对主网的钱包操作信心。
4. **与其他用户互动**:通过测试网与其他开发者或加密货币用户进行交流,学习最佳实践,从而加快成长。
开发者在选择测试网而非主网进行开发时,主要有以下几方面原因:
1. **经济成本低**:测试网对开发者几乎没有成本,可以利用免费获得的比特币进行测试,避免在主网中使用真正的比特币可能产生的成本。
2. **快速迭代**:在测试网上进行开发和测试时,开发者可以快速验证代码的可行性,无需等待主网的确认,从而加快项目进程。
3. **避免网络拥堵**:主网的拥堵状况可能会影响交易速度,使用测试网则可以避免这些问题,确保测试过程的顺利进行。
4. **模拟真实场景**:测试网提供与主网相似的环境,允许开发者模拟实际应用场景,但不会受到主网的限制和影响。
当你在测试网中完成了所有需要测试的功能以及应用开发,下一步便是将这些功能迁移到主网。以下是一些步骤:
1. **审计和**:在切换之前,务必对代码进行审计和,确保性能及安全性达到标准。
2. **搭建主网钱包**:根据测试网所使用的钱包,创建一个正式的主网钱包,并备份好私钥及种子短语。
3. **小规模测试**:在主网中先进行小额交易,确保功能正常,并检查实际情况与测试网的效果是否一致。
4. **逐步迁移**:功能完成后逐步迁移,避免一次性全部结构迁移,这样能降低风险。
随着加密货币的技术不断发展,测试网的未来亦是光明。在未来,测试网可能会有以下发展趋势:
1. **更高的性能与安全性**:随着技术的演进,测试网会不断提升其性能和安全性,确保开发者在测试时获得最佳环境。
2. **更多功能集成**:开发者可能引入更多各类功能和工具,使得测试网更为丰富,能够覆盖更多的应用场景。
3. **社区参与增强**:随着比特币用户不断增长,开发者与社区间的互动也会更多,以推动技术进步和生态完善。
总的来说,随着比特币技术的进步与应用范围的扩展,测试网的意义也愈发凸显。无论是新手还是老手,使用比特币测试网钱包都能在一定程度上为个人的加密旅程提供帮助与启示。